NHPC Investing Rs 35K Cr To Set Up 5 Power Projects In JK, Will Return To PDC 40 Years Later
SRINAGAR: India’s hydropower giant, NHPC has signed MoUs with Jammu and Kashmir Power Development Corporation (JKPDC) to invest Rs 35,000 Cr in setting up five power projects in Jammu and Kashmir. The MoU was signed in presence of Raj Kumar Singh, Union Minister of State (Independent Charge) for Ministry of Power, Manoj Sinha, Jammu and Kashmir Lieutenant Governor and Dr Jitendra Singh, MoS, PMO.

Nearly 17 lakh pilgrims visit Mata Vaishno Devi this year
JAMMU: Even as the pilgrimage to the world famous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Shrine was disrupted for five months from the period of mid of March to mid of August, nearly 17 lakh pilgrims paid obeisance at the Bhawan situated in Trikuta Hills of mountainous Reasi district of Jammu and Kashmir.
The pilgrimage for the first time in the history was stopped on March 18, 2020 in view of COVID pandemic and by this time, 12,52,734 pilgrims had paid obeisance at the cave shrine.
In the month of January, 5,12,569, in February 3,96,683 and from 1 to 18 March, 3,43,482 pilgrims visited to the cave shrine and offered prayers but thereafter the yatra was immediately stopped in view of COVID pandemic, which forced Centre announce countrywide lockdown.
